About this property
Located in a popular residential area, within catchment of local primary and secondary schools, this detached property in brief comprises, entrance hall, two reception rooms, kitchen dining room, utility and WC. Whilst to the first floor are four bedrooms, bathroom and shower room. With front and rear gardens, driveway parking for several vehicles and a garage. With double glazing throughout and gas central heating.
